Output 3c2c6b8490683a033dcafba0ba3e2027f780790f6f156dd5fdfba68d3cf7d609:1

value
3621862
script pubkey
OP_0 OP_PUSHBYTES_20 cc8cdfb06297fe192490f7fcc80638294f56d32c
address
bc1qejxdlvrzjllpjfys7l7vsp3c9984d5ev4nczqh
transaction
3c2c6b8490683a033dcafba0ba3e2027f780790f6f156dd5fdfba68d3cf7d609
spent
true